COSMIC X-RAY-BACKGROUND FROM HOT GAS

In this paper we consider constraints on models of the cosmic X-ray background (XRB) in which the XRB is produced by optically thin thermal bremsstrahlung from hot gas. We show that models in which the gas is gravitationally confined in a spherical configuration and is heated only once are contradicted by the observed number of gravitationally lensed quasars together with the lower limit on the number of XRB sources required by limits on fluctuations in the XRB and the cosmic microwave background (CMB). In addition, we show that for models in which the gas is not gravitationally confined, the expansion time of the gas is much shorter than the radiative cooling time, so that such models cannot explain the XRB. We conclude that thermal bremsstrahlung models cannot account for the XRB if the emitting gas is heated only once.
